Core Marketing Pillars

Follow strategic principles to maximize conversions while maintaining official account status.

🛡️ Meta Policy Compliance

Understand Meta's strict policies on promotional messaging. Avoid spam terminology, write clear offers, and ensure your message templates match approved categories to prevent account suspension.

📊 Opt-in & Database Health

Only send templates to customers who have explicitly opted in to receive updates. Clean your lists regularly, remove inactive numbers, and respect unsubscribe prompts immediately.

⚡ High-Converting Copywriting

Write short, engaging, and action-oriented message copy. Use line breaks, bold key values, include dynamic personalization variables, and place interactive CTA buttons at the bottom.

Marketing & Pacing Tactics

Optimize Template Headers

Instead of plain text, use rich media headers. Delivering an engaging product image, seasonal discount coupon banner, or downloadable PDF catalog increases CTR by up to 30%.

Implement Opt-Out Quick Replies

Always include an 'Opt-Out' or 'Stop' quick-reply button in promotional templates. Letting uninterested users unsubscribe easily prevents them from reporting your number, keeping your rating green.

Stagger & Stagger Broadcast Pacing

Never broadcast to 50,000 users all at once. Pacing your delivery in hourly waves helps you monitor replies and prevents your customer support agents from being overwhelmed by incoming chats.

Compliance & Optimization FAQs

Meta rejects templates if they contain spelling errors, look like spam, use threatening language, or are submitted in the wrong category (e.g. submitting marketing copy as utility).

A/B testing involves sending two different template variants (e.g. different images or CTA text) to small sample groups to select the variant with the highest CTR for the main broadcast.

Typically, broadcasting mid-morning (10 AM - 12 PM) or mid-afternoon (3 PM - 5 PM) results in the highest open and response rates. Avoid sending late-night campaigns.
